What happened on my birthday

1451
Sultan Mehmed II, the Conqueror inherits the throne of the Ottoman Empire.

1509
The Battle of Diu, naval battle at port of Diu, India between Portugal and the Ottoman Empire, establishes Portugese trading control.

1870
US state of Iowa ratifies the 15th Amendment of the United States Constitution allowing suffrage for all races & colour.

1928
Paleoanthropologist Davidson Black reports his findings on the ancient human fossils found at Zhoukoudian, China in the journal Nature and declares them to be a new species he names'Sinanthropus pekinensis' (now known as'Homo erectus').

1966
1st soft landing on Moon (Soviet Luna 9).

Holidays on Saturday, February 3rd

National Wear Red Day
National Wear Red Day is a special day where everyone wears red clothes to help spread the word about preventing heart disease and strokes, especially in women.

National Women Physicians Day
National Women Physicians Day, celebrated on February 3rd, honors the birthday of Elizabeth Blackwell, the first female doctor in the U.S., and celebrates the achievements and growing presence of women in the medical field.

National Woman's Heart Day
National Woman's Heart Day, celebrated on the first Friday in February, is all about wearing red to raise awareness for women's heart health.

Feed the Birds Day
Feed the Birds Day, celebrated every February 3rd, encourages us to help out our feathered friends by providing them with food as their winter supplies start to dwindle, just before spring arrives.

Four Chaplains Day
Four Chaplains Day is a day to remember four brave chaplains who gave up their life jackets to save others when their ship was sinking during World War II.
